TWO PAIRS, 19TH C. FRENCH GILT BRONZE CANDLESTICKS
French, 19th century. Two pairs of gilt bronze candlesticks comprising, a pair of Empire candlesticks with jasper on triparte griffin base, and a pair of Charles X candlesticks with fluted spreading shafts with paw feet on triparte base, all apparently unmarked.
Provenance: The Collection of Diana McCluskey, Tampa, FL; Empire candlesticks acquired at The Popular Auction, Flemington, NJ, August 27, 2016, Lot 25, Charles X candlesticks acquired at A.B. Levy's Palm Beach Auction, February 23, 2014, Lot 122.
Approximate dimensions: Empire candlestick h. 8.75", w. 3.5", d. 4"; Charles X candlestick h. 12.5", w. 5.25", d. 4.5".
Condition: Stem under the marble of one Empire candlestick slightly raised exposing square section, nozzle of one Empire candlestick is cracked, no apparent chips to jasper, nozzles of the Charles X candlesticks associated and crimped to adapt, some gilt loss.
